KDE 월렛을 비활성화하는 방법?


27

나는 한 달 전에 Ubuntu Maverick (Gnome)을 사용하고 있습니다 .Update Manager가 새로운 업데이트를 알릴 때마다 평소와 같이 업데이트되었습니다. 일어난 일은 호출 된 프로그램 kdewallet 이 내 컴퓨터에 설치되어 있고 암호가 필요한 것을하려고 할 때마다 svn팝업이 나타나고 실제로 성가 시게됩니다. 어떻게 제거 할 수 있습니까? Synaptic Package Manager에도 없습니다.


"kde"로 태그를 지정했습니다. Gnome 또는 KDE를 사용하고 있습니까? (확실히
말해서

내가 아는 한 우분투는 그놈을 사용하고 쿠분투는 KDE를 사용합니다. 맞습니까? kde-something이라는 프로그램이 왜 내 컴퓨터에서 실행되는지 모르겠습니다!
David Weng

답변:


26

KDE 5 / 플라즈마 5.8 :

끝에 다음 줄을 추가하십시오. ~/.config/kwalletrc

[Wallet]
Enabled=false

플라즈마를 다시 시작하십시오.

KDE4 :
KDE 월렛은 KDE의 핵심 부분이며 패키지에 kdebase-runtime있습니다.

실행을 중지하고 kcmshell4 kwalletconfig3 단계에서 계속하거나 처음부터 시작하려면 다음을 수행하십시오.

  1. 시스템 설정 시작
  2. 계좌 정보 열기
  3. "KDE 월렛"탭으로 이동
  4. KDE Wallet 서브 시스템 사용을 선택 취소 하십시오.
  5. Apply변경 사항을 적용하고 설정 창을 닫으 려면 클릭하십시오 .

kdebase-runtime패키지에 의존하는 프로그램 목록을 얻으려면 다음을 실행하십시오.

 apt-cache --no-enhances --no-suggests --no-recommends --installed rdepends kdebase-runtime

Ubuntu에서 출력은 "kdebase-runtime [newline] Reverse Depends :"만 표시합니다. 쿠분투에서는 전체 목록이 다음과 같습니다.


2
나는 System settings당신이 말하는 것을 찾을 수 없습니다 , 나는 우분투를 사용하고 있습니다. 쿠분투의 경우인지 모르겠습니다!
David Weng

1
@David Weng : kcmshell4 kwalletconfig명령을 직접 실행 해보십시오 . 당신의 출력을 붙여 넣을 수 apt-cache --no-enhances --no-suggests --no-recommends --installed rdepends kdebase-runtimepaste.ubuntu.com 과 코멘트에 링크를 추가?
Lekensteyn 2016 년

이것은 일부 애플리케이션에서는 작동하지만 크롬에서는 작동하지 않습니다. 여러 개의 kwallet이 떠 있기 때문에 생각합니다. 참조 superuser.com/questions/994551/...
jozxyqk

(K) 우분투 15.10에서는 더 이상 작동하지 않습니다.
Paŭlo Ebermann

1
플라즈마 kcmshell5 kwalletconfig5에서 나를 위해 일했습니다.
zoechi

9

다음과 같이 "KDE 월렛 시스템"대화 상자 (Chrome을 시작할 때마다)를 제거했습니다.

  1. 편집 ~/.config/kwalletrc(아래 참고 참조) 및 추가

    [Wallet]
    Enabled=false
    
  2. kdewallet 데몬을 종료하십시오 :
    pkill kdewallet5(또는 killall kdewallet5)

소스 코드 ( kde.org 또는 Github 미러 ) 를 살펴볼 때이 옵션을 찾았습니다 .

퍼팅 경우 kwalletrc에하는 것은 ~/.config작동하지 않습니다, 당신의 시스템은 아마도 구성 파일을 저장하기 위해 다른 디렉토리를 사용합니다. 구성 파일은로 식별되는 디렉토리에 만들어 QStandardPaths::GenericConfigLocation지므로 qtpaths경로를 찾아 보았습니다 ( ~/.config= /home/rob/.config경우).

$ qtpaths --paths GenericConfigLocation
/home/rob/.config:/etc/xdg

참고 : kwallet을 완전히 비활성화하지 않고 Chrome에서만 비활성화하려면 chrome에서 kwallet 팝업 비활성화--password-store=basic 에서 설명한대로 플래그를 사용할 수 있습니다 . 래퍼 스크립트 또는 단축키를 통해 Chrome을 시작하는 경우 kwallet이 필요한 경우를 사용 하는 것이 좋습니다 . Chrome을 개발하기 때문에이 플래그를 사용하는 대신 kwalletd를 비활성화했으며 실행 할 때 마다이 플래그를 추가하는 것이 불편합니다 .--password-store=basic./chrome

(아키 리눅스에서 테스트되었지만 우분투에서도 작동합니다. 구성 디렉토리를 찾는 sudo apt-get install qttools5-dev-tools데 사용 하려면 사용하십시오 qtpaths).


6

나는 처형했다.

  1. 시스템 설정을 시작하십시오 .
  2. 고급 탭으로 이동 하십시오.
  3. 보도 KDE 지갑 아이콘입니다.
  4. KDE Wallet 서브 시스템 사용을 선택 취소 하십시오 .

운영체제 : Ubuntu 10.04.4 LTS.


우분투 14.04 (신뢰)에서 2 단계는 이제 " 계정 정보로 이동 "입니다.


3

우분투 16.04.LTS를 사용 하고이 경로에서 'kdwalletrc'파일을 찾았습니다.

~/.kde/share/config/kdwalletrc

kdeWallet을 비활성화하려면 'Enable'옵션을 'true'에서 'false'로 전환하십시오.

[Wallet]
Close When Idle=false
Enabled=false

16.04 시스템을 보면 ~ / .kde / share /가 표시되지만 구성 디렉토리는 없습니다. 재부팅 할 때마다 KDE 월렛 시스템에 여전히 메시지가 표시됩니다.
John

0

특정 응용 프로그램에 대해 kwallet을 비활성화하려면 다음과 같이 실행하여 해당 응용 프로그램의 dbus를 닫을 수 있습니다

env DBUS_SESSION_BUS_ADDRESS=none chrome 

0

비밀번호 필수 알림 사용 안함

이력서

KDE 메뉴 => 시스템 환경 설정 => 알림 => 지갑 (드롭 다운) => 비밀번호 필요 옵션 => 팝업 표시 (확인 해제) => 재부팅.

기술

나는 스페인어이고 옵션은 다른 번역을 할 수 있습니다.

나는 KDE Plasma 5.12를 사용 합니다. KDE 메뉴를 열고 "시스템 환경 설정"을 검색 하고 클릭하십시오. 이제 "알림"을 검색하십시오 . 창 오른쪽 상단에 드롭 다운이 표시됩니다. 필자의 경우 이미 "접근성" 옵션을 선택한 다음 변경하고 "지갑"을 선택하십시오 . 마지막 단계에서 "password required" 옵션을 클릭 하고 show pop up 또는 이와 유사한 항목 (아래쪽)을 선택 취소하십시오 . 저장하고 재부팅하십시오 :-).

도움이되기를 바랍니다.이 성가신 알림을 비활성화 할 수 있습니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.